The POSITIONS

 

COVID-19 Community Evaluator (Senior Management Analyst)

This position creates a review process to evaluate the effectiveness of COVID-19 response programs by developing feedback methods, conducting user interviews, and recording results for evaluation. Duties include but are not limited to: monitoring and evaluating quality improvement initiatives through data collection and analysis; designing and developing data collection measures and program evaluation tools; identifying program improvement initiatives by working closely with program staff and community members; and developing and implementing community-based participatory research projects.

EXAMPLES OF DUTIES:

  • Plans analytical studies to be performed; defines and clarifies problem areas; determines research methodology, identifies data sources, and designs survey instruments; establishes timeframes for study completion.
  • Assembles required data; designs questionnaires, conducts interviews, makes observations, researches files and literature, surveys other organizations and documents findings.
  • Collects and analyzes information; utilizes computer-based and statistical techniques where appropriate; evaluates alternative problem solutions.
  • Makes recommendations for action; prepares narrative and/or statistical reports, including implementation strategies; makes presentations to management or the Board of Supervisors as required.
  • Prepares policies, procedures, and other written documentation; monitors legislative and regulatory changes that may affect unit operations and recommends necessary changes.
  • Serves in a consultative role to departmental management on administrative and related issues and strategies; provides significant input into policy, operational and service delivery decisions; assists line management in the implementation and facilitation of policy and programmatic changes.
  • Represents the agency or department and serves as liaison with other County departments and agencies in areas of   mutual concern; confers with representatives of governmental, business and community organizations and the public; may serve on a variety of task forces.
  • May assist with or perform specific administrative services, such as negotiating and administering contracts for services, assisting with the development of the budget; writing grant applications and specifications for proposal, and designing computerized systems and data bases.
  • Interprets and applies a variety of policies, rules, and regulations; provides information which may require tact and judgment to employees and others.
  • Operates a variety of standard office equipment, including a word processor and/or computer; may drive a County or personal vehicle to attend meetings.
  • Perform other duties as assigned within the county classification.

 

Vaccination Data Coordinator (Senior Management Analyst)

EXAMPLES OF DUTIES:

  • Plans, directs, reviews, and evaluates the work of a small professional staff; trains staff in work procedures; recommends staff selection and implements discipline as required.
  • Plans analytical studies to be performed; defines and clarifies problem areas; determines research methodology, identifies data sources, and designs survey instruments; establishes timeframes for study completion.
  • Collects and analyzes information; utilizes computer-based and statistical techniques where appropriate; evaluates alternative problem solutions.
  • Consults with COVID Division management on administrative and related issues and strategies.
  • Works with the vaccination registration platform to track programmatic needs and updates.
  • Acts as a liaison between the main vaccination data source and other parts of the COVID-19 response including but not limited to COVID-19 Leadership, Communications, Healthy Schools, and Behavioral Health.
  • Ensures a high-quality user experience of the registration platform.
  • Establishes and implements standardized registration flow and processes.
  • Maintains the flow of vaccination data into the data platform and track receipt and storage.
  • Produces reports and analytics based on the vaccination data.
  • Maintains a vaccination calendar that provides information in a single place about current and upcoming vaccination activities.
  • Assists in the maintenance of a map view of vaccination sites and related services.
  • Perform other duties as assigned within the county classification.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S:

EDUCATION: The equivalent to graduation from a four-year college or university (180 quarter units or 120 semester units) with major coursework in business or public administration, or a field related to the work. (Additional professional or para-professional administrative services experience may be substituted for the education on a year-for-year basis.); AND,

EXPERIENCE: The equivalent to one year of full-time, professional-level experience in the planning and conduct of management, operational, policy or programmatic analyses and studies, preferably in a public agency setting.
